Abstract

A power manager for a mobile device comprises a traffic shaping unit () and a management unit (). The traffic shaping unit is incorporated into a networking layer () of a mobile device architecture. The traffic management unit spans application layer () and networking layer () of the mobile device architecture. The traffic shaping unit and management unit are connected via a feed path (). The management unit () is provided with inputs () to receive measurements of external parameters (to). The management unit further comprises a processor () to process the received measurements and a traffic shaping function generator () to receive the processed measurements and generate a traffic shaping function. The management unit () inputs the generated traffic shaping function to the traffic shaping unit () via the feed path (), whereby the traffic management unit controls transmissions from the mobile device.
